Notice how the layout is different vs. Each main panel was expanded inward and the stacked panels were resized too. The GIMP interface is made up of a left and right panel. The middle of the interface is where you work on your documents. Inside of the main panels are additional smaller panels that contain options for your tools, layers, and more depending on the tab.
Each of those tool panels can be rearranged. Plus, they can be resized as well as the main panels. When you open GIMP for the first time, your panels are most likely in a different position vs. You can do the same. The toolbox consists of the tool options and is updated with those options based on the tool selected. By default, the toolbox is auto placed under the tool icons when first installed. Table of Contents. Color – this design style I like to refer to as retro. At least in terms of what the icons looked like for GIMP in older versions. Legacy – similar to “Color. Not recommended! Symbolic – a flat design similar to Photoshop. This is my personal preference. Symbolic Inverted – same as Symbolic except the colors are inverted. The higher the resolution, the smaller the icon. Use Icon Size From the Theme – icon size will default to the size created for that theme.
Custom Icon Size – this is my personal choice. Use the slider underneath to adjust from Small, Medium, Larger, or Huge. I like Huge! How To Change the Preview Sizes. Click on the tab name and drag to the left, right, up, or down. Release the mouse position where you’d like the tab to move to. If that position is available, your panel will move to that location! For the main left and right panels, click on the inner side and drag to the left or right to expand it. If you have panels stacked on each other, click the three dots in-between and drag up or down to extend.
Click the tab of an inner panel and drag to the opposite main panel. If you have multiple tabs, they are auto arranged side-by-side. GIMP provides the tools needed for high quality image manipulation. From retouching to restoring to creative composites, the only limit is your imagination. GIMP gives artists the power and flexibility to transform images into truly unique creations.
GIMP is used for producing icons, graphical design elements, and art for user interface components and mockups. GIMP provides top-notch color management features to ensure high-fidelity color reproduction across digital and printed media.
